 stipeS0763400 (stīp)n. A supporting stalk or stemlike structure, especially the stalk of a pistil, the petiole of a fern frond, or the stalk that supports the cap of a mushroom.[French, from Latin stīpes, post.]
 stipe(staɪp) n1.  (Botany) a stalk in plants that bears reproductive structures, esp the stalk bearing the cap of a mushroom2.  (Botany) the stalk that bears the leaflets of a fern or the thallus of a seaweed3.  (Zoology) zoology any stalklike part; stipes[C18: via French from Latin stīpes tree trunk; related to Latin stīpāre to pack closely; see stiff]stipe(staɪp)
 n.    1.  a stalk or slender support, as the petiole of a fern frond, the stem supporting the pileus of a mushroom, or a stalklike elongation of the receptacle of a flower.    2.  stipes.  [1775–85; < French < Latin stīpes post, tree trunk or branch, log]
